The seventh power conference head coaching opening surfaced in Baton Rouge Sunday. LSU football fired Brian Kelly , which ends a four-season run with the Tigers .

This CFB season has witnessed high-profile openings sprout like never before. UCLA and Penn State represent the biggest ones available in the Big Ten. Oklahoma State parted ways with its own longtime head coach Mike Gundy. But the Southeastern Conference has seen Florida, Arkansas and now LSU all open.

Kelly's tenure in Death Valley featured one Heisman Trophy winner in Jayden Daniels. Yet Kelly failed to replicate the success he built at Notre Dame, where he won 113 games. No LSU team led by Kelly won an SEC title, or even clinch a College Football Playoff spot.
